What Are FIBC Bags?

What Do FIBC Bags Do?

Flexible Intermediate Bulk Containers (FIBC), or bulk bags, are the unsung heroes of industrial packaging. They store, transport, and handle powdered, flaked, or granular materials. Made from woven polypropylene, these bags are tough yet light, making them perfect for hauling large quantities without breaking a sweat.

You’ll find FIBC bags in all sorts of places—farms, construction sites, chemical plants, and food processing facilities. They’re easy to move around, especially when you use a forklift. Different Kinds of FIBC Bags

Not all FIBC bags are created equal. Here’s a quick rundown to help you pick the right one for your needs.

  1. Type A FIBC Bags: These are your basic bags made from untreated polypropylene. They’re good for non-flammable stuff where static electricity isn’t an issue.

  2. Type B FIBC Bags: Similar to Type A but with a twist—they prevent brush discharges, making them safer in dusty environments.

  3. Type C FIBC Bags: These are the conductive ones. Made from non-conductive polypropylene with conductive threads, they need to be grounded to avoid static charges. Perfect for flammable settings (Ferrier Industrial).

  4. Type D FIBC Bags: Made from antistatic fabric, these bags don’t need grounding. They safely dissipate static electricity, making them ideal for flammable powders and granules.

  5. Food-Grade FIBC Bags: Made from virgin polypropylene, these bags meet strict hygiene standards, making them perfect for food products. Check out our section on food-safe fibc bags for more info.

  6. Ventilated FIBC Bags: These bags have breathable fabric, making them great for perishable goods like produce. For more details, see our article on ventilated big bags produce.

Electrostatic Charge Considerations

Static electricity can be a real danger, especially in flammable environments. Forklift-friendly bulk bags need to handle this to keep things safe during filling and emptying.

  • Conductive Materials: Some bags use conductive materials to stop static electricity from building up. These materials help get rid of any charge, cutting down the risk of sparks. Ferrier Industrial has conductive FIBC bags for this (Ferrier Industrial).

  • Grounding Mechanisms: Adding grounding mechanisms to the bags makes them even safer. These mechanisms make sure any charge goes straight to the ground, avoiding sparks and possible fires.
